Contextual Info: 19-3943; Rev 1; 8/06 27-Bit, 2.5MHz to 42MHz DC-Balanced LVDS Deserializers The MAX9248/MAX9250 digital video serial-to-parallel converters deserialize a total of 27 bits during data and control phases. In the data phase, the LVDS serial input is converted to 18 bits of parallel video data and in the control phase, the input is converted to 9 bits of parallel control data.
